The Role

Our stores are the life and soul of our business.

They act as our main touch points with our ever‑evolving consumer base.

As the world of retail evolves, we believe that for all other parts of the chain to work, our stores must set the tone of what our two brands are all about.

The Supervisor plays a key role in achieving these standards, leading by example and inspiring their teams through passion and belief in our brands.

Responsibilities

  • Ensure the efficient running of the shop floor to achieve the highest levels of customer service, sales and profit.
  • Support the management team in all personnel, product & merchandising functions, business processes and results for the store.
  • Participate in weekly management meetings and other staff meetings.
  • Communicate to staff all marketing and sales promotions.
  • Drive shop‑floor sales and exceed store targets by motivating the team and offering customers an exemplary store journey.
  • Foster a positive store experience by treating all customers and colleagues fairly and consistently.
  • Ensure consistent training on product knowledge and store maintenance for the team.
  • Achieve company standards for personal sales results: sales vs. budgets, sales per hour and units per transaction.
  • Perform manager‑on‑duty functions, manage store opening/closing and sales floor operations.
  • Focus staff on building quality relationships with internal & external customers.
  • Build a repeat customer base by providing unparalleled spirited service.
  • Execute visual merchandising best practices and review them regularly.
  • Work with the management team to build a talent pool for key positions, including potential successors.

About You

  • Previous supervisory or specialist roles within a premium or luxury brand.
  • People‑management experience with conflict resolution skills.
  • Effective communicator who builds relationships easily.
  • Team player who recognises and celebrates contributions and achievements of others.
  • Confident in giving feedback that promotes positive behavioural change.
  • Adaptable and able to work quickly in a fast‑moving environment.
  • Energetic and authentic with a clear presence on the shop floor.
  • Can-do attitude and initiative to find in‑store solutions.
